Low Current Technician
Job Description Roles & Responsibilities Install, configure, and maintain low-current systems and equipment. Perform testing and commissioning of CCTV, Access Control, Fire Alarm, PA, and Structured Cabling systems. Troubleshoot and rectify faults in low-current systems. Conduct preventive and corrective maintenance activities. Read and interpret technical drawings, schematics, and wiring diagrams. Ensure all installations comply with project specifications and safety standards. Coordinate with engineers, supervisors, and clients during project execution. Prepare maintenance reports and service records. Support system upgrades, modifications, and expansions. Ensure proper documentation and inventory management of tools and materials. Desired Candidate Profile Diploma/Technical Certification in Electronics, Electrical Engineering, Telecommunications, or a related field. Relevant certifications in CCTV, Fire Alarm, or Security Systems are preferred. 1–3 years of experience in low-current systems. Knowledge of CCTV systems (IP and Analog). Experience with Access Control and Time Attendance Systems. Understanding of Fire Alarm Systems and relevant standards. Familiarity with Structured Cabling (Cat6, Fiber Optic). Ability to use testing and diagnostic tools. Basic networking knowledge (IP addressing, switches, routers). Good troubleshooting and problem-solving skills.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
